Mind Map Overview
1. Understanding Audio Design Principles
- Balance: Achieving a harmonious blend of different audio elements.
- Contrast: Using differences in sound to create emphasis or highlight specific elements.
- Rhythm: The temporal pattern of sound, which can be used to guide the listener’s attention.
- Harmony: The pleasing combination of different sounds, often achieved through frequency relationships.
2. Types of Audio Elements
- Sound Sources: Natural sounds, environmental sounds, and synthesized sounds.
- Sound Effects: Pre-recorded or generated sounds used to simulate real-world events.
- Music: Composed sound sequences that can set the mood or convey a narrative.
- Ambient Sounds: Background sounds that create a sense of place or atmosphere.
3. Audio Design Processes
- Analysis: Understanding the context in which the audio will be used.
- Conceptualization: Developing the overall audio vision for the project.
- Creation: Recording, synthesizing, and editing audio elements.
- Integration: Combining audio elements into the final product.
4. Aesthetic Considerations
- Emotional Impact: The emotional response the audio design aims to evoke.
- Brand Consistency: Aligning the audio design with the brand identity.
- Accessibility: Ensuring the audio is comprehensible and enjoyable for all users.
5. Technical Implementation
- Software Tools: Digital audio workstations (DAWs), sound libraries, and virtual instruments.
- Hardware Devices: Microphones, speakers, and audio interfaces.
- Programming: Utilizing code to automate or enhance audio processing.
Detailed Exploration
1. Understanding Audio Design Principles
Balance
- Achieve balance by mixing different audio elements at appropriate levels.
- Example: In a game, balancing the volume of ambient sounds with character dialogue ensures clarity without overwhelming the listener.
Contrast
- Use dynamic range to create contrast between loud and soft sounds.
- Example: In a film, a sudden drop in volume can heighten the tension during a suspenseful moment.
Rhythm
- Incorporate rhythm to guide the listener’s attention to key moments.
- Example: In a presentation, a subtle rhythmic pattern can emphasize important data points.
Harmony
- Create harmony by selecting sounds that complement each other.
- Example: In a piece of music, harmonizing melodies can create a pleasing auditory experience.
2. Types of Audio Elements
Sound Sources
- Use natural sounds for authenticity, such as rain or birdsong.
- Example: In a nature documentary, recorded natural sounds enhance the immersive experience.
Sound Effects
- Generate sound effects using synthesis or sampling.
- Example: In a video game, a custom sound effect for a character’s attack can make the game more engaging.
Music
- Compose music that reflects the mood and style of the project.
- Example: In a horror film, a dark, unsettling melody can heighten the sense of dread.
Ambient Sounds
- Create ambient sounds to establish a specific setting or atmosphere.
- Example: In a virtual reality experience, ambient sounds can transport the user to another world.
3. Audio Design Processes
Analysis
- Conduct research to understand the target audience and the context of use.
- Example: Analyzing user feedback from a previous game to improve the audio design for a sequel.
Conceptualization
- Develop a clear vision for the audio design, considering the overall project goals.
- Example: Sketching out the desired emotional journey for a user experience.
Creation
- Record or synthesize audio elements, then edit them to fit the project’s needs.
- Example: Using a DAW to layer multiple sound effects and adjust their timing for a seamless experience.
Integration
- Combine audio elements with the visual and interactive elements of the project.
- Example: Synchronizing sound effects with on-screen actions in a video game.
4. Aesthetic Considerations
Emotional Impact
- Choose sounds that align with the desired emotional response.
- Example: In a therapeutic app, soft, calming sounds can help users relax.
Brand Consistency
- Ensure the audio design reinforces the brand identity.
- Example: Using a specific jingle or sound effect in all marketing materials for a company.
Accessibility
- Make the audio design accessible to users with disabilities, such as providing subtitles for audio descriptions.
- Example: Designing an app with adjustable audio levels to accommodate users with hearing impairments.
5. Technical Implementation
Software Tools
- Utilize DAWs like Pro Tools, Ableton Live, or FL Studio for audio production.
- Example: Editing a sound effect in Pro Tools to remove unwanted background noise.
Hardware Devices
- Invest in quality microphones, speakers, and audio interfaces for recording and playback.
- Example: Using a condenser microphone for capturing clear, detailed audio.
Programming
- Use programming languages like Python or JavaScript to automate audio processing tasks.
- Example: Writing a script to dynamically adjust the volume of ambient sounds in a game based on the player’s actions.
